One cup of Baby clam is around 236.1 grams and contains approximately 350.0 calories, 58.3 grams of protein, 5.6 grams of fat, and 14.2 grams of carbohydrates.

Baby Clam is a delicious and nutritious seafood delight. These small, tender mollusks are packed with protein, omega-3 fatty acids, and essential vitamins, making them a heart-healthy choice. Originating from coastal waters around the world, baby clams are commonly featured in Mediterranean and Asian cuisines, with their subtle briny flavor shining in soups, pasta dishes, and stir-fries. Low in calories yet rich in nutrients, baby clams are a fantastic option for those seeking a tasty and healthy addition to their meals. Nutrition Information

1 cup (236.1g)
Calories
350.0
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 5.6 g 7%
Saturated Fat 1.1 g 5%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0 g
Cholesterol 158.3 mg 52%
Sodium 283.3 mg 12%
Total Carbohydrates 14.2 g 5%
Dietary Fiber 0 g 0%
Sugars 0 g
protein 58.3 g 116%
Vitamin D 0 mcg 0%
Calcium 255.6 mg 19%
Iron 66.7 mg 370%
Potassium 1483.3 mg 31%

* Percent Daily Values are based on a 2,000 calorie diet. Your daily values may be higher or lower depending on your calorie needs.
